Global Landscape of DC Disconnect Systems

As the world pivots toward renewable energy, the DC Disconnect Box has emerged as a critical safety linchpin in modern power infrastructure. From sprawling solar farms in the Australian Outback to residential rooftop arrays in Germany, the demand for reliable isolation switches is at an all-time high. Unlike standard AC systems, DC circuits in photovoltaic (PV) installations present unique challenges, such as sustained electrical arcing, which requires specialized engineering to manage safely.

Today's industrial status reflects a shift toward higher voltages—moving from 1000V to 1500V systems—to improve efficiency and reduce BOS (Balance of System) costs. This evolution has forced DC Disconnect Box manufacturers to innovate rapidly, integrating smarter sensing technologies and weatherproofing that exceeds IP66 standards. Emerging Trends in DC Power Management

1500V High-Voltage Support

Transitioning from 1000V to 1500V to maximize string length and lower system losses in utility-scale solar projects.

Automated Isolation

Integration of remote-trip functions and automated load breaking to interface with smart fire safety protocols.

Extreme Durability

Materials engineered for UV resistance and anti-corrosion, specifically for coastal and desert environments.

The Strategic Importance of DC Disconnect Boxes in Modern Energy

The safety of a photovoltaic system is only as strong as its weakest component. The DC Disconnect Box serves as the emergency shut-off point between the PV array and the inverter. In the event of a fault, maintenance, or fire, the ability to rapidly and cleanly break the DC circuit is vital. Our boxes are engineered to handle inductive loads and prevent arc-flash incidents, which are much more difficult to extinguish in DC environments than in AC ones.
